Use helpers defined in pyjailhouse/sysfs_parsers.py to gather the information needed to determine if a machine can run jailhouse from sysfs. Make checking sysfs the default action when running jailhouse-hardware-check (instead of checking a compiled configuration file).
Minor changes to pyjailhouse import warning.
